It’s a bit of a localized nationwide political proxy war in Old Dominion that could offer some previews of the next year.
Republicans want to keep control of the state House and flip the state Senate, where they are outnumbered 18-22.
Youngkin and Republicans have emphasized transparent government, schools and particularly transgender policies, and fiscal responsibility, along with a ban on abortion after 15th week of pregnancy, with exceptions. Democrats have emphasized the abortion issue.
Republicans have spent $4M. Democrats have spent $7M.
Youngkin has spent considerable time, effort, and capital campaigning for Republicans in the state. Biden, Harris, the Maryland governor have all campaigned for Democrats, and Obama has been robocalling the past two weeks to get out the left vote.
Also, the entire notorious transgender crime coverup, fbi informant, silencing, reporting, and arresting parents Loudon School Board is on the ballot. Let’s see if any of them lose their seats.
***UPDATE BELOW***
Welp, the shine has worn off Youngkin. It was not a good night for him and Republicans.
- Republicans lost control of the House, where they did hold a 52-48 majority. Right now, the election is headed to a 47-53 Democrat majority with two races still being counted.
- Republicans hoped to flip the Senate, where they were outnumbered 18-22. Right now, the election results are headed to a 17-23 advantage for Democrats.
- In an election year riddled with controversial transgender school issues that were emphasized by Youngkin and Republicans in the elections…Virginia voters just elected the first ever transgender to the State Senate in response.
- Regarding the controversial Loudoun County School Board, all 9 seats (8 Democrats, 1 independent) were up for election. The results are now 7 Democrats, 1 independent, and 1 Republican.

quote:
Democrats ran largely on preserving abortion access, launching a wave of ads that declared a vote for their party was a vote to stop Youngkin from passing his proposal to ban most abortions after 15 weeks. Youngkin had portrayed that plan as a reasonable limit because it would have allowed exceptions for cases of rape and incest and when the mother’s life or physical health is at risk. The GOP effort to defuse abortion as a motivating issue for Democratic-leaning voters wasn’t enough to stop the tide in the suburban battlegrounds. In an interview, Jamie Lockhart, executive director of Planned Parenthood Advocates of Virginia, said “abortion rights won.” “Voters showed up,” Lockhart said.
quote:
In another Northern Virginia contest, Del. Danica Roem, D-Prince William, triumphed over Republican Bill Woolf, making her the first transgender person ever elected to the state Senate.
